## Formula sandbox tuning

User-supplied formulas in Gridmoor execute inside a restricted interpreter with hard ceilings on time, memory, and call depth. Reviewers should confirm any change to these ceilings is justified in the PR description, since raising them widens the abuse surface. Defaults were chosen from production traces. The current limits are as follows.

limits module of tafog-fawip:
WEIGHTS = {
    "julix": 57,
    "lamys": 992,
    "kasvan": 209,
    "quenok": 750,
    "alddor": 259,
    "oliath": 1009,
    "wenix": 815,
}

### Step 4: Work around the flaky DNS

Our Bramblecote boxes sometimes fail to resolve the internal resolver on first boot — you'll see intermittent timeouts hitting the config service. The fix is to pin the resolver address and let the Larkspool agent cache lookups locally. That agent needs a token to register with the cache coordinator, so before restarting it, add this line to the deploy .env.

sealed setting: VAULT_KEY13=e858d6c3bf8c1

MEMO — Kettling Depot Receiving

Uniform sets for the new Kettling depot arrive Wednesday via Ashgrove courier: 40 boxes, sorted by size, manifest attached to box one. Check the count at the dock before signing; shortages go straight to stores, not the courier. The hand-over instruction the courier will follow is set out below.

drop instructions, tafof-baguf: the holmir gilox courier leaves the sormir ulaok holdor ledger at gate 5596 under passcode 257343